MAY 2010: TuDiabetes.org, a social network for people touched by diabetes, has partnered with Children’s Hospital Boston in the creation and launch of a new application called “TuAnalyze.” The application enables members to submit a key health metric known as Hemoglobin A1C as part of a massive data donation drive.
